One can find, in the phase space and the parameter space, sufficiently large region where the N-body problem (for any N) is integrable in the classical sense. These bodies have large relative velocities and the close approaches are absent. On the other hand, the families of trajectories with regular approaches are constructed. These families are similar to a stochastic process even for small N and naturally are non-integrable. Intermediate cases are also considered.
